반응형

백준

    [BOJ][파이썬, 자바]11660 구간 합 구하기5

    ✨ 문제 링크 Idea : 누적합을 이용한 부분합 구하기(행 마다 누적합 구한 후 구간합으로 자르기) 이차원배열의 내용들을 쭉 편 후 일차원배열에 누적합을 구한 후 사용하려 했으나 그렇게 하면 시작부분이 첫번 째 열이 아닐시에 빠지는 부분이 있다 예를 들어, 아래와 같은 입력 예제에서 위와 같은 방법을 사용하면 (2, 2)에서 (3, 4)에 해당하는 구간을 구하면 3 + 4 + 5 + 4 + 5 + 6이 나와야하나 처음 언급한 방식으로 접근하면 3까지 포함된다. 1 2 3 4 2 3 4 5 3 4 5 6 4 5 6 7 따라서 행 마다의 누적합을 구한 후 입력에 따라 구간합으로 짤라서 사용한다 자바 코드 import java.io.BufferedReader; import java.io.IOException..

    백준을 풀면 자동으로 내 깃허브에 커밋을? (BaekjoonHub, 백준허브)

    🙊문제를 풀기만 하면 내 깃허브에 자동으로 문제요약과 커밋을 ? 대부분의 사람들이 코딩테스트 준비나 알고리즘을 공부할 때 가장 많이 사용하는 사이트 중 하나가 백준(BOJ)일 것이다 많은 문제를 풀다보면 내가 무엇을 풀었는지 까먹기도하고 다시 복습하고 싶을 때 찾기도 힘들다 이를 위해서 많은 사람들이 Github에 자신이 푼 문제를 저장해두곤 하는데 매번 풀 때 마다 저장하기도, 문제를 복사 하기도 힘든 것이 현실이다. 초보자의 경우 어떤 형식으로 저장해야할지 부터 고민을 해야하니 😂 그런데 백준에서 문제를 풀기만하면 자동으로 자신이 지정한 레파지토리에 커밋이 되는 기능이 생겼다... 해당 기능은 알고리즘 오픈카톡의 홍보글에서 본 내용인데 내용들은 아래와 같다 안녕하세요? 저는 백준허브의 개발자 flax..